diff --git a/app/Models/User.php b/app/Models/User.php index 9fd2be78bc3e..2b4210ca7174 100644 --- a/app/Models/User.php +++ b/app/Models/User.php @@ -190,9 +190,7 @@ class User extends Authenticatable implements MustVerifyEmail $truth = app()->make(TruthSource::class); if ($this->company){ - return $this->company; - } elseif($truth->getCompany()){ return $truth->getCompany(); diff --git a/app/Providers/AppServiceProvider.php b/app/Providers/AppServiceProvider.php index 2206abe686fb..ee6c6775d724 100644 --- a/app/Providers/AppServiceProvider.php +++ b/app/Providers/AppServiceProvider.php @@ -19,6 +19,7 @@ use App\Utils\TruthSource; use Illuminate\Cache\RateLimiting\Limit; use Illuminate\Database\Eloquent\Relations\Relation; use Illuminate\Queue\Events\JobProcessing; +use Illuminate\Support\Facades\App; use Illuminate\Support\Facades\Blade; use Illuminate\Support\Facades\Queue; use Illuminate\Support\Facades\RateLimiter; @@ -61,17 +62,10 @@ class AppServiceProvider extends ServiceProvider ]); } - // Queue::before(function (JobProcessing $event) { - // // \Log::info('Event Job '.$event->connectionName); - // \Log::error('Event Job '.$event->job->getJobId); - // // \Log::info('Event Job '.$event->job->payload()); - // }); - //! Update Posted AT - // Queue::after(function (JobProcessed $event) { - // // \Log::info('Event Job '.$event->connectionName); - // \Log::error('Event Job '.$event->job->getJobId); - // // \Log::info('Event Job '.$event->job->payload()); - // }); + /* Ensure we don't have stale state in jobs */ + Queue::before(function (JobProcessing $event) { + App::forgetInstance('truthsource'); + }); app()->instance(TruthSource::class, new TruthSource()); diff --git a/resources/views/portal/ninja2020/components/livewire/payments-table.blade.php b/resources/views/portal/ninja2020/components/livewire/payments-table.blade.php index 9797ed1f22a5..1c9c5010d8b5 100644 --- a/resources/views/portal/ninja2020/components/livewire/payments-table.blade.php +++ b/resources/views/portal/ninja2020/components/livewire/payments-table.blade.php @@ -57,8 +57,7 @@ {{ $payment->translateDate($payment->date, $payment->client->date_format(), $payment->client->locale()) }} - - {{ $payment->translatedType(); }} + {{ $payment->translatedType() }} {!! \App\Utils\Number::formatMoney($payment->amount, $payment->client) !!}